Kelly Cook has been named the new Director of Member Relations for the Junction City Area Chamber of Commerce.
With nearly three decades of experience in workforce development, program management, and leadership across educational and recreational institutions, Kelly brings knowledge and expertise to the Chamber team.
As the former Director of Workforce Development at Cloud County Community College, Kelly consistently demonstrated his ability to spearhead initiatives that prepare students for diverse industries and forged strategic partnerships with industry leaders to align programs with market demands.
At Kansas State University, he supported student success and academic excellence as a Program Associate. His leadership roles at Manhattan Area Technical College and Seward County Community College, stand as a testament to his strategic vision in enhancing educational experiences and promoting wellness and athletic development.
